Features

High-resolution 12-bit

The DHO900 series offers a 12-bit vertical resolution with 4096 levels of quantization, 16 times more precise than 8-bit resolution. This upgrade significantly enhances waveform measurement accuracy, particularly in critical applications like power ripple testing and medical equipment detection.

Support Type-C Power

The Type-C power supply interface design of the DHO900 series allows the device to be powered by a single portable power bank, meeting the requirements of on-site chip testing and circuit maintenance, among other applications.

Supports Bode Plot Analysis

The DHO900S is equipped with the Bode diagram loop analysis function, facilitating switch-mode power supply loop analysis and amplitude-frequency response testing of components. This advanced feature enhances the device's capabilities, allowing for comprehensive analysis and optimization of power supply systems and component performance.

Standard Digital Channels

The entire DHO900 series comes standard with digital channels, which, when paired with the PLA2216 logic analysis probe, enables digital signal analysis. This solves the problem of simultaneous analog and digital signal debugging needs in electronic design.

Rich triggering and decoding functions

The DHO900 has a rich set of triggering functions, including commonly used edge, slope, pulse width, etc., as well as some serial protocol triggering, such as the triggering and decoding of the I2C, SPI, RS232 protocols commonly used in embedded debugging and the CAN, LIN protocols commonly used in the automotive industry. The bus triggering and decoding functions of the DHO900 can accurately capture and parse protocol information, directly display the decoded content on the waveform or present it in the form of an event table, making your debugging more convenient and intuitive.
